SVG passports ranked 19th Globally

Summary by Searchlight
AS OF APRIL, 2026, the St.Vincent and the Grenadines passport is ranked 19th globally with a mobility score of 146–157 on the Henley Passport Index 2026, offering a mobility score and access to over 146 countries, which includes visa-free access to 100 destinations and visa-on-arrival for 40 others. The Vincentian passport demonstrated significant strength over the past decade, rising from 38th place in 2006 to its current, highly ranked status,…

Singapore defends its top place as the most powerful passport in the world – with access to 192 of 227 countries without a visa. Germany, on the other hand, slips out of the Top Ten.
